National player Mathias Böhm changes ligainters!

The EC Red Bull Salzburg has signed a young Austrian player with striker Mathias Böhm. The 22-year-old native of Klosterneuburger comes from the Vienna Capitals and is said to give the squad of the Red Bulls more depth.

Mathias Böhm grew up at the Juniors of the Vienna Capitals and made the leap into the Vienna professional team step by step. On the way there he was also part of the squad of the Austrian U18 and U20 national team. The striker, which has grown 1.90 meters tall, made his debut in the 2021/22 season at the age of 18 in the Vienna Capitals’ professional team, but played for two years in the AHL or Austrian U20 league. In the last two seasons, Böhm then played full of Win2day Ice Hockey League (83 SP | 7 t | 10 a) and showed his potential even in several missions in the Austrian national team.

Statement Manny Viveiros, Head Coach EC Red Bull Salzburg

“Mathias is a very talented player who can help us achieve our goals. We look forward to working with him, further developing him and taking advantage of his potential as an ice hockey player.”
